Beginning Guitar Class Starts JANUARY 25th!

Hosted by the Dallas Guitar Academy and RL Turner High School. Beginner class, geared towards adults (18+), high school students (age 13+) WELCOME with parental consent. Why spend a fortune on private lessons if you don't have to? Save money and make friends too! Next Session Starts January 25th When: Wednesday's 7 - 9 pm, startingJanuary 25th Where: RL Turner High School - 1600 S. Josey Lane, Carrollton, TX, 75006 (park behind the school in the west lot near the JROTC building, at the intersection of Kirby Rd. and Perry Rd. Enter the main school building through the double doors facing the left side of the parking lot, the guitar class meets in the school cafeteria.) Requirements: Guitar, Electronic Tuner, Positive Attitude! Computer w/Internet helpful but not required.
